High Quality Content by WIKIPEDIA articles! Yannus Sufandi (born 2 January 1980) is an Indonesian-born Australian actor and choreographer. Born in Java, Indonesia, Yannus grew up in Australia. His credits as a Choreographer include “So You Think You Can Dance" Australia and Malaysia Season 1 and Season 2, guest judge and presenter for the TV show “One Million Dollar Dance Battle” on MTV Taiwan, the ”Nickelodeon Kids Choice Awards” Australia, ACN Australian Flash Mob, and Raymond Weil. His acting credits include Fidelio, Aida, Lady Mcbeth of Mtsensk, Tales of Hoffman, Julius Caesar, Turandot and Madama Butterfly Opera - all performed at the Sydney Opera House. Sufandi has performed with touring productions such as Rumba 2002 Australian Tour and Martell VSOP Malaysian Tour 2002 and 2004, and Vietnamese Pop singers Australian tour 2009. Sufandi has performed live on stage for televised productions such as the Aria Awards (Australian Music Awards) 2002/2004, Urban Music Awards and OZ Music Awards. He has performed in support acts and promotional tours for 2001-02 Destiny's Child Australian Tour, Black Eyed Peas Promo Tour, Pharrel Promo Tour, Fatman Scoop and Mis-Teeq Promo Tour.
